[Inhalt] [Zurück] [Weiter] [Thema] [Index]

SendMail()


Syntax:

SendMail (S smtphost, S addr, S from, S subj, S msg [, S datei, ...]) : S
smtphost: Hostname oder Hostname:Port des Mailhosts
addr: Mailadresse des Empfängers
from: Absender
subj: Betreff
msg: Anschreiben ohne Anhang
datei: optional eine oder mehrere Dateien als Anhang

Beispiel:

err := SendMail ("mail.ab.de", "user@ab.de", "abo@toposoft.de", "Abo", msg, "abo.pdf")

Beschreibung:

Versendet eine Mail an addr per SMTP über smtphost. subj ist das Betreff, msg das Anschreiben. Darauf können optional ein oder mehrere Namen von Dateien folgen, die der Mail als Anhang angehängt werden.

War das Senden erfolgreich, wird ein Leerstring zurückgeliefert, sonst die Fehlermeldung.

Wenn mehrere Dateien angehängt werden sollen, können die Namen auch mit Leerzeichen getrennt in einem String übergeben werden.

Beispiel: err := SendMail (host, user, from, "Abo", msg, "abo.pdf abo.asc zwei.asc")

statt err := SendMail (host, user, from, "Abo", msg, "abo.pdf", "abo.asc", "zwei.asc")

Siehe auch GetPop3Mail() und FTPPut().



toposoft 19.04.2024